Signs You Might Have a Water Leak

Not all leaks are visible, and some can go undetected for weeks or months, causing serious damage to your home. Here are some common signs that you may have a water leak:

  • Increased Water Bills: A sudden spike in your water bill is often a sign of an undetected leak. Even a small leak can waste gallons of water each day.
  • Damp or Wet Spots: If you notice wet spots on your floors, walls, or ceilings, you might have a hidden leak within your plumbing system.
  • Mold or Mildew: Persistent dampness from a leak can lead to mold or mildew growth, creating unhealthy conditions in your home.
  • Low Water Pressure: If you experience a drop in water pressure, it could be due to a leak in your water lines.
  • Unusual Sounds: Hearing water running or dripping when no faucets are on can indicate a hidden leak.

If you notice any of these signs, it’s important to schedule a leak detection service as soon as possible to prevent further damage.

Our Water Leak Detection Process

At Total Plumbing, we use a combination of advanced techniques and tools to locate water leaks quickly and accurately. Our leak detection process includes:

  1. Initial Inspection: Our licensed plumbers will begin with a thorough inspection of your home’s plumbing system to identify potential problem areas.
  2. Advanced Technology: Using geophones to detect sound vibrations, air pressure systems to test for leaks, and line locators to trace the exact path of your pipes, we check your plumbing from all angles to pinpoint the leak’s location.
  3. Comprehensive Solutions: After detecting the leak, we’ll provide you with a range of repair options, from simple pipe repairs to more extensive solutions such as rerouting pipes or replacing sections of damaged plumbing.
  4. Accurate Repairs: Our team will perform the necessary repairs quickly and efficiently, using high-quality materials to ensure long-lasting results.
Preventative Measures to Avoid Future Water Leaks

While leaks can sometimes occur unexpectedly, there are steps you can take to reduce the likelihood of future leaks in your home:

  • Regular Plumbing Inspections: Schedule annual plumbing inspections to catch any issues before they develop into major problems.
  • Monitor Your Water Bill: Keep an eye on your water bill for any unexplained increases, which could indicate a hidden leak.
  • Upgrade Old Pipes: If your home has older plumbing, consider upgrading to modern materials such as copper or PEX piping, which are more resistant to leaks and corrosion.
  • Check Water Pressure: Ensure that your water pressure is set to an appropriate level, as high pressure can cause strain on pipes and increase the likelihood of leaks.

By taking these preventative steps, you can protect your home from costly water damage and avoid future leaks.
